Genesis 3:21

Made Simple — Modern English Translation

Translated by Verse Made Simple Editorial
KJV ORIGINAL
Unto Adam also and to his wife did the LORD God make coats of skins, and clothed them.
Close to the original. Clear modern English.
✦ MADE SIMPLE

The LORD God made clothing from animal skins for Adam and his wife, and dressed them.

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

God is showing care and provision for Adam and Eve even after they disobeyed Him, making them proper clothing to cover themselves.

📚 Historical Context

In the Garden of Eden, after Adam and Eve disobeyed God by eating the forbidden fruit, they realized their nakedness and attempted to cover themselves with fig leaves as a sign of shame. God, demonstrating His mercy, provided them with more suitable garments made from animal skins, which likely involved the first animal sacrifice and foreshadowed the need for atonement through blood. This act highlights the beginning of God's redemptive plan for humanity's sin.
